(Reuters] – Apple Inc. (NASDAQ:), is delaying a plan that requires employees to be at work 3 days a week because of rising COVID-19 incidences, Bloomberg News reported nL3N2V73MG.

Reuters reached out to the iPhone manufacturer for clarification but they did not respond immediately.

Bloomberg reported in March that Apple employees would need to be working from home at least twice per week starting April 11. Bloomberg also cited an internal memo stating that Apple staff would then have to report to the office no less than three times per week beginning May 23.
